Exploring the Power of Poetry in Expressing Grievances
The chapter delves into the nuances of form and language in poetry through a discussion on the poem 'Declaration.' It highlights how poetry serves as a redress for grievances and the struggles faced by Black citizens in America. The conversation emphasizes the importance of bringing the question of Black life into national conversations with a love for America.
